Description

In 1911 the world was on the brink of change and nowhere was this change more evident than in the fashions of French designer Paul Poiret. The most famous designer of his generation was also the host of the first great party of the 20th Century: The Thousand and Second Night, an Arabian Nights inspired event. When Philadelphia department store heir Nathan Wanamaker travels to Paris to learn to be a buyer for his family’s store, he receives an invitation to the party. It is here that he begins to develop an unusual friendship with the self-proclaimed “King of Fashion.”  Surrounded by Poiret’s extravagances, Stravinsky’s music, and Picasso’s art, Nathan soon finds himself having to make the difficult choice of what he must bring back with him to Philadelphia and what he must leave behind in Paris.
